Aktyw Forum

Zarejestruj się na forum.ep.com.pl i zgłoś swój akces do Aktywu Forum. Jeśli jesteś już zarejestrowany wystarczy, że się zalogujesz.

Sprawdź punkty Zarejestruj się

RTOS na AVR

tdolata
-
-
Posty: 18
Rejestracja: 6 gru 2004, o 10:56
Lokalizacja: Poznań

RTOS na AVR

Postautor: tdolata » 6 gru 2004, o 11:02

Napisałem prosty system operacyjny na prcesory AVR w avr-gcc.
Szukam osób zainteresowanych rozwojem tego projektu (b-testerów i użytkowników). Zaiteresowanych proszę o pobranie kodów źródłowych i napisanie swojej opinii na temat. Z góry dziękuję.

[ Dodano: 06-12-2004, 10:47 ]
podstawowe parametry:
- konfigurowalny na poziomie kompilacji tzn. za pomocą #define włączamy poszczególne właściwości
- preemptive/cooperative
- round robin (wątki o tym samym priorytecie współdzielą czas procesora)
- dziedziczenie priorytetów
- funkcje statystyczne (obciążenie procesora przez poszczególne wątki, zużycie stosu)
- semafory, mutexy, kolejki, zdarzenia i inne możliwości synchronizacji wątków
- sterowniki do urządzeń (do tej pory: wewnętrzny USART i sterowniki do W3100A)
Załączniki
tOS.rar
(127.46 KiB) Pobrany 1019 razy

Arrek
-
-
Posty: 117
Rejestracja: 18 wrz 2003, o 20:41
Lokalizacja: wawa

Postautor: Arrek » 6 gru 2004, o 16:16

Mysle ze to co zrobiles przerasta mozliwosci wiekszosci urzytkownikow tego forum. Ale moze ktos z odpowiednia wiedza na temat OS-ow sie znajdzie.

Nie wyprobowalem Twojego systemu, ale wyglada na to ze jest to super sprawa...

tdolata
-
-
Posty: 18
Rejestracja: 6 gru 2004, o 10:56
Lokalizacja: Poznań

Postautor: tdolata » 7 gru 2004, o 09:28

Mysle ze to co zrobiles przerasta mozliwosci wiekszosci urzytkownikow tego forum. Ale moze ktos z odpowiednia wiedza na temat OS-ow sie znajdzie.

Nie wyprobowalem Twojego systemu, ale wyglada na to ze jest to super sprawa...
Mam nadzieje, ze w 40M kraju znajdzie sie kilka osob, ktore beda tym zainteresowane (sam znam kilka, a to juz cos). Mysle, ze nie bedzie tak źle.

Dzieki za dobre słowo. Daj znać jak już go przetestujesz.

Toker
-
-
Posty: 19
Rejestracja: 29 lis 2004, o 00:39
Lokalizacja: Kraków

Postautor: Toker » 10 gru 2004, o 01:51

Witam
No bardzo cikawy temat :)
jak znajde troche czasu to z checia zainteresuje sie
Pozdrawiam

Gienek1
-
-
Posty: 56
Rejestracja: 8 wrz 2003, o 16:27
Lokalizacja: Tarn-Góry

Postautor: Gienek1 » 24 gru 2004, o 11:57

Czy możesz to spakować zipem ? Chętnie się dołączę.

fantom
-
-
Posty: 1
Rejestracja: 23 gru 2004, o 13:28
Lokalizacja: Lódź

Postautor: fantom » 28 gru 2004, o 12:02

Sprawa bardzo ciekawa ale... zasobozernosc nie do przyjecia dla zwyklego mikrokontrolera.W wolnej chwili z checia dopisze kilka sterownikow do wykorzystywanych przeze mnie urzadzen.Pozdrawiam.

tdolata
-
-
Posty: 18
Rejestracja: 6 gru 2004, o 10:56
Lokalizacja: Poznań

Postautor: tdolata » 28 gru 2004, o 13:04

Sprawa bardzo ciekawa ale... zasobozernosc nie do przyjecia dla zwyklego mikrokontrolera.W wolnej chwili z checia dopisze kilka sterownikow do wykorzystywanych przeze mnie urzadzen.Pozdrawiam.
Faktycznie trochę to zajmuje, ale opracowałem to dla atmega128 więc flash mnie za bardzo nie interesował (ale w razie czego mam wersję mini tylko 500 bajtów, ale oczywiście bez większości opcji). Pamięć RAM to zupełnie inna sprawa - musi jej trochę być, w końcu każdy wątek ma osobny stos i kontekst.
Za sterowniki z góry dziękuję. Jeśli możesz to mi je podeślij.

Awatar użytkownika
morph13
-
-
Posty: 61
Rejestracja: 25 lut 2003, o 08:15
Lokalizacja: Siedlce
Kontaktowanie:

Postautor: morph13 » 26 lip 2010, o 13:22

Faktycznie trochę to zajmuje, ale opracowałem to dla atmega128 więc flash mnie za bardzo nie interesował (ale w razie czego mam wersję mini tylko 500 bajtów, ale oczywiście bez większości opcji). Pamięć RAM to zupełnie inna sprawa - musi jej trochę być, w końcu każdy wątek ma osobny stos i kontekst.
Za sterowniki z góry dziękuję. Jeśli możesz to mi je podeślij.
czy możesz umieścić tą wersje super odchudzoną ??

Awatar użytkownika
r-mik
-
-
Posty: 324
Rejestracja: 14 cze 2005, o 19:18
Lokalizacja: Wawa
Kontaktowanie:

Re: RTOS na AVR

Postautor: r-mik » 20 mar 2016, o 14:20

Jak widać projekt padł

Wróć do „AVR/AVR32”

Kto jest online

Użytkownicy przeglądający to forum: Obecnie na forum nie ma żadnego zarejestrowanego użytkownika i 5 gości